Asbestos Cancer judgment may help thousands in the future

Asbestos cancer claim specialists Corries highlight a recent case which may help asbestos cancer victims in the future. The case of Heynike v Birlec Limited (1) Mod(2) and Special Metals Wiggin Limited 2018 will make a real change to cases where someone was exposed to asbestos as a contractor on another employers site. What is IPF? -Keith Chegwin’s death -Your Questions answered

The death of much loved television presenter Keith Chegwin has shocked many of us. Keith Chegwin has sadly died due to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is, known as IPF. What is IPF?
